Alterations in visual function and retinal structure in patients with bipolar disorder.

Marta Comes-Carsí1, José Miguel Vilaplana-Mora1, Laura Manfreda-Domínguez1

  • 1Servicio de Oftalmología, Hospital Clínico Universitario de Valencia, Valencia, Spain.

Archivos De La Sociedad Espanola De Oftalmologia
|May 19, 2025
PubMed
Summary

Bipolar disorder patients show poorer visual function and thinner retinal nerve fiber and ganglion cell layers compared to healthy individuals. These findings highlight potential ocular biomarkers for bipolar disorder.

Area of Science:

  • Ophthalmology
  • Neuroscience
  • Psychiatry

Background:

  • Bipolar disorder is a complex mental health condition.
  • Ocular structures may be affected in patients with bipolar disorder.

Purpose of the Study:

  • To investigate differences in visual function and retinal structure between bipolar disorder patients and healthy controls.

Main Methods:

  • A cross-sectional observational study compared 82 bipolar disorder patients (163 eyes) with 43 controls (86 eyes).
  • Visual function was assessed using best-corrected visual acuity (BCVA) with high and low contrast charts.
  • Retinal structure was analyzed using Optical Coherence Tomography (OCT), focusing on the nerve fiber layer (RNFL) and ganglion cell layer (GCL).

Main Results:

  • Bipolar disorder patients exhibited significantly lower BCVA at high and low contrasts compared to controls (p < 0.05).
  • OCT revealed significantly reduced mean RNFL and GCL thickness in bipolar disorder patients (p = 0.007).
  • No significant differences in RNFL or GCL thickness were found between bipolar I and bipolar II disorder subtypes.

Conclusions:

  • Significant differences in visual function and retinal layer thickness exist between bipolar disorder patients and healthy individuals.
  • RNFL and GCL thinning are potential structural correlates of visual function deficits in bipolar disorder.
